Stamkos signs five-year deal with Lightning

Star centre Steven Stamkos signs five-year deal with the Tampa Bay Lightning.

The Tampa Bay Lightning have re-signed star centre Steven Stamkos on a five-year deal.

After a long summer of negotiations, the restricted free agent agreed to terms with the Bolts for a deal worth a reported $37.5m (£23m).

Stamkos, 21, played in all 164 games during the previous two seasons, leading the NHL with 96 goals.

The Ontario native made his Stanley Cup Playoffs debut in 2011, playing in all 18 games before the Lightning fell to eventual champions Boston in the Eastern Conference Finals.

“Steven is extremely important to this franchise and is part of the foundation of our hockey team,” Lightning general manager Steve Yzerman said. “We are very pleased to have him signed and look forward to seeing him in a Lightning uniform for years to come.”
